The global pandemic acted as a catalyst, accelerating the adoption of remote work across various sectors. As businesses scrambled to maintain operations amid lockdowns and social distancing measures, the flexibility of remote work became not only a necessity but also a revelation. Social media jobs, in particular, thrived in this environment. From content creation and community management to digital marketing and analytics, a plethora of roles emerged that could be seamlessly executed from home offices.


One of the primary drivers behind the boom in work-from-home social media jobs is the universal accessibility of social media platforms. With billions of users worldwide, platforms like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, LinkedIn, and TikTok have become indispensable tools for businesses aiming to connect with their audiences. This global reach necessitates a workforce that can operate beyond the confines of traditional office spaces, tapping into diverse markets and time zones.


Moreover, the nature of social media work inherently lends itself to remote execution. Tasks such as crafting engaging posts, analyzing user engagement metrics, strategizing marketing campaigns, and even interacting with followers can all be accomplished with just a laptop and an internet connection. This has opened doors for individuals from various backgrounds and locations to enter the field, democratizing access to employment opportunities that were once limited by geographical constraints.


The flexibility offered by work-from-home social media jobs is another significant draw for job seekers. As traditional nine-to-five workdays give way to more adaptable schedules, professionals can tailor their work hours to suit personal preferences and responsibilities. This flexibility is particularly appealing to parents, caregivers, and individuals pursuing further education, allowing them to balance their professional and personal lives more effectively.


For businesses, the benefits of hiring remote social media professionals are manifold. By tapping into a global talent pool, companies can access a diverse range of skills and perspectives that enrich their social media strategies. Additionally, the cost savings associated with remote work, such as reduced office space and overhead expenses, are substantial. This financial advantage can be redirected towards enhancing marketing efforts and investing in employee development.


However, the rise of work-from-home social media jobs is not without its challenges. The virtual nature of these roles can sometimes lead to feelings of isolation and disconnection from colleagues. To combat this, companies are increasingly investing in virtual team-building activities and communication tools that foster collaboration and camaraderie among remote workers. Regular video calls, online brainstorming sessions, and digital workshops are just a few of the strategies being employed to maintain a sense of community and shared purpose.


Furthermore, the fast-paced and ever-evolving landscape of social media requires professionals to stay abreast of the latest trends and technologies. Continuous learning and adaptability are crucial in this field, as platforms frequently update their algorithms and introduce new features. To remain competitive, remote social media professionals must engage in ongoing education and skill development, whether through online courses, webinars, or industry conferences.
